Coffee-Pecan Cake

Ingredients:


1 1⁄2 sticks (3⁄4 cup) unsalted butter, softened
1 1⁄2 cups sugar
2 tsp baking powder
2 tsp vanilla extract
4 large eggs
2 1⁄4 cups all-purpose flour
1 cup milk
1 1⁄2 cups pecan halves or pieces
1 tsp maple-flavor extract

Frosting:

1⁄3 cup heavy (whipping) cream
1 tsp instant coffee
1 1⁄4 cups confectioners’ sugar

Garnish:

1⁄3 cup confectioners’ sugar, thinned with about 3⁄4 tsp water until runny

Preparation:

Heat oven to 350°F. Line inside of a 9-in. springform cake pan with 18-in.-wide heavy-duty foil. Coat with nonstick spray. Have a rimmed baking sheet ready.

Spread pecans on baking sheet. Bake 8 minutes or until toasted. When cool, pulse in a food processor just until finely chopped.

Beat butter, sugar, baking powder, vanilla and maple extract in a large bowl with mixer on high 3 minutes or until fluffy. Add eggs, 1 at a time, beating well after each. On low speed, beat in flour in 3 additions alternately with milk in 2 additions, just until blended, scraping sides of bowl as needed. Fold in chopped nuts. Spoon into prepared pan; spread smooth.

Bake 1 hour or until a wooden pick inserted in center comes out clean. Cool in pan on a wire rack 10 minutes. Remove pan side; invert cake on rack; remove foil. Cool completely.

Frosting:
Pour cream into a medium bowl; stir in instant coffee until dissolved. Stir in confectioners’ sugar with a whisk until smooth. Spread over top of cake, letting some run down sides.

Garnish:
Scrape sugar mixture into a small ziptop bag. Snip tip off 1 corner; drizzle over frosting.

Note: Wrapped cake can be refrigerated up to 1 week or frozen up to 2 months. Bring to room temperature before frosting. Frosted cake can be refrigerated up to 4 days.
